Nurturing a Perennial Paradise

Embrace the joy of a garden that blooms year after year. A perennial paradise is not just a collection of plants; it's a vibrant tapestry woven with strategically chosen species that return season after season, offering a continual display of color and texture. By selecting the right plants, you can create a abundant landscape that requires minimal upkeep while providing maximum beauty.

Launch your journey by assessing your garden's conditions. Consider factors like sunlight exposure, soil type, and rainfall to pinpoint the ideal perennials for your region.

Showcase the perks of a perennial paradise:

  • Low maintenance
  • Stunning blooms throughout the year
  • Biodiversity support
  • Budget-friendly in the long run

With a little planning, you can revitalize your garden into a perennial haven that provides solace for years to come.

Creating Harmony with Trees, Shrubs, and Ferns

Blending verdant greenery into your landscape can be a truly rewarding experience. To achieve a harmonious arrangement that captivates, consider the interplay between majestic trees, graceful shrubs, and delicate ferns. Trees provide structure, their canopy offering shade and a sense of immensity. Shrubs complement the texture with their colorful blooms, while ferns add a touch of intrigue with their delicate foliage.

  • Embrace diversity in size, shape, and color to create a dynamic tapestry.
  • Layer plantings to introduce different heights and textures throughout the year.
  • Consider the preferences of each plant, ensuring they receive adequate exposure and moisture.

By means of thoughtful planning and determination, you can create a harmonious oasis that reflects the tranquility of nature.
